Request for Comments on Incentivizing Humanitarian Technologies and Licensing Through the Intellectual Property System
Document Number: 2010-23395
Type: Notice
Date: 2010-09-20
Agency: Department of Commerce, United States Patent and Trademark Office, Patent and Trademark Office
The United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) is considering pro-business strategies for incentivizing the development and widespread distribution of technologies that address humanitarian needs. One proposal being considered is a fast-track ex parte reexamination voucher pilot program to create incentives for technologies and licensing behavior that address humanitarian needs. Because patents under reexamination are often the most commercially significant patents, a fast-track reexamination proceeding would allow patent owners to more readily and less expensively affirm the validity of their patents. Therefore, the opportunity to utilize a voucher for a fast-track reexamination proceeding could provide a valuable incentive for entities to pursue humanitarian technologies or licensing. The USPTO is requesting comments from the public regarding this proposal as well as other incentive proposals set forth in this notice.
American Community Survey 5-Year Data Product Plans
Document Number: 2010-23373
Type: Notice
Date: 2010-09-20
Agency: Department of Commerce, Bureau of the Census, Census Bureau
The Bureau of the Census (Census Bureau) currently releases American Community Survey (ACS) data products in the form of 1-year estimates and 3-year estimates. Most recently, the 2008 ACS 1-year estimates were released in September 2009, and the 2006-2008 ACS 3-year estimates were released in October 2009. By this notice, the Census Bureau announces plans for the release of ACS 5-year data products covering the period of 2005-2009. The release of the ACS 5-year estimates will achieve a goal of the ACS to provide small-area data similar to the data published after Census 2000, based on the long-form sample. This notice provides general information on the Census Bureau's modifications to its current line of ACS data products to accommodate the 5-year estimates.

Pacific Halibut Fisheries; Limited Access for Guided Sport Charter Vessels in Alaska
Document Number: 2010-23267
Type: Rule
Date: 2010-09-17
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S issues regulations amending the limited access program for charter vessels in the guided sport fishery for Pacific halibut in the waters of International Pacific Halibut Commission Regulatory Area 2C (Southeast Alaska) and Area 3A (Central Gulf of Alaska). These regulations revise the method of assigning angler endorsements to charter halibut permits to more closely align each endorsement with the greatest number of charter vessel anglers reported for each vessel that a charter business used to qualify for a charter halibut permit. This action is necessary to achieve the halibut fishery management goals of the North Pacific Fishery Management Council.
Fisheries Off West Coast States; Coastal Pelagic Species Fisheries; Annual Specifications
Document Number: 2010-23254
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2010-09-17
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S proposes a regulation to implement the annual harvest guideline (HG) for Pacific mackerel in the U.S. exclusive economic zone (EEZ) off the Pacific coast. This HG is proposed according to the regulations implementing the Coastal Pelagic Species (CPS) Fishery Management Plan (FMP) and establishes allowable harvest levels for Pacific mackerel off the Pacific coast. The proposed total HG for the 2010-2011 fishing year is 11,000 metric tons (mt) and is proposed to be divided into a directed fishery HG of 8,000 mt and an incidental fishery of 3,000 mt.

Fisheries of the Northeastern United States; Atlantic Herring Fishery; Total Allowable Catch Harvested for Management Area 1B
Document Number: 2010-23018
Type: Rule
Date: 2010-09-15
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ration
NMFS announces that, effective 0001 hours, September 14, 2010, federally permitted vessels may not fish for, catch, possess, transfer, or land more than 2,000 lb (907.2 kg) of Atlantic herring in or from Management Area 1B (Area 1B) per trip or calendar day until January 1, 2011, when the 2011 total allowable catch (TAC) becomes available, except for transiting purposes as described in this notice. This action is based on the determination that 95 percent of the Atlantic herring TAC allocated to Area 1B for 2010 is projected to be harvested by September 14, 2010. Regulations governing the Atlantic herring fishery require publication of this notification to advise vessel permit holders that no TAC is available for the directed fishery for Atlantic herring harvested from Area 1B.

Patent Examiner Technical Training Program
Document Number: 2010-23006
Type: Notice
Date: 2010-09-15
Agency: Department of Commerce, United States Patent and Trademark Office
The United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) is seeking public assistance in providing technical training to patent examiners within all technology centers. The Patent Examiner Technical Training Program (PETTP) is intended to provide scientists and experts as lecturers to patent examiners in order to update them on technical developments, the state of the art, emerging trends, maturing technologies, and recent innovations in their fields. Such guest lecturers must have relevant technical knowledge, as well as familiarity with prior art and industry practices/standards in areas of technology where such lectures would be beneficial.

Establishment of the Federal Economic Statistics Advisory Committee and Intention To Recruit New Members
Document Number: 2010-22985
Type: Notice
Date: 2010-09-15
Agency: Department of Commerce, Economics and Statistics Administration
The Secretary of Commerce is announcing the establishment of and intention to recruit new members of a Federal Advisory Committee. In accordance with the provisions of the Federal Advisory Committee Act, 5 U.S.C. App. 2, and the General Services Administration rule on Federal Advisory Committee Management, 41 CFR part 101-6.1001, the Secretary of Commerce has determined that the establishment of the Federal Economic Statistics Advisory Committee (the ``Committee') within the Economics and Statistics Administration (ESA), is in the public interest in connection with the performance of duties imposed on the Department by law. The Committee will advise the Directors of ESA's two statistical agencies, the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) and the U.S. Census Bureau (Census), and the Commissioner of the Department of Labor's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) on statistical methodology and other technical matters related to the collection, tabulation, and analysis of Federal economic statistics. The Committee will function solely as an advisory committee to the senior officials of BEA, Census and BLS (the Agencies) in consultation with the Committee chairperson. Important aspects of the Committee's responsibilities include, but are not limited to: a. Recommending research to address important technical problems arising in Federal economic statistics. b. Identifying areas in which better coordination of the Agencies' activities would be beneficial. c. Establishing relationships with professional associations with an interest in Federal economic statistics. d. Coordinating, in its identification of agenda items, with other existing academic advisory committees chartered to provide agency- specific advice, for the purpose of avoiding duplication of effort. The Committee will report to the Under Secretary for Economic Affairs who, as head of ESA, will coordinate and collaborate with the Agencies. The Committee will consist of approximately fourteen members who serve at the pleasure of the Secretary of Commerce. Members shall be nominated by the Department of Commerce, in consultation with the Agencies, under the coordination of the Under Secretary for Economic Affairs, and appointed by the Secretary of Commerce. Committee members shall be economists, statisticians, survey methodologists, and behavioral scientists and will be chosen to achieve a balanced membership across those disciplines. Members shall be prominent experts in their fields, and recognized for their scientific and professional achievements and objectivity. The Department intends to recruit new members of the Committee that meet these membership criteria through a separate Federal Register notice and application process in the near future. The Committee will function solely as an advisory body, in compliance with the provisions of the Federal Advisory Committee Act. The Charter will be filed under the Federal Advisory Committee Act.
